Nigeria head into Cameroon as one of the most successful nations on the continent, and with three Africa Cup of Nations titles to back up their claim, they are one to keep an eye out for and undoubtedly favourites to go all the way.
However, following their last triumph back in 2013, when they edged out a dogged Burkina Faso side 1-0 courtesy of Sunday Mba‘s winner, the Super Eagles endured a horrid run in the continental tournament, failing to qualify for the subsequent two editions.
Tonight’s opener against the Pharaohs of Egypt is going to be another test for the Austin Eguavoen led Super Eagles team in Cameroon.
Nigeria head into Tuesday’s game unbeaten in all but one of their last six competitive games, picking up four wins and one draw to book a spot in the playoffs of the 2022 World Cup qualifiers after finishing first in Group C, two points ahead of second-placed Cape Verde.
